Discoloured teeth
Hi, I brush thoroughly every morning yet my teeth are yellowing. I want to understand if there is a dental process to get my teeth whitened and the general practise to keep them white. Thanks.

Hi... Tooth discoloration is quite common problem. First of all you need to know whether the stains are intrinsic or extrinsic. Treatment options differ depending on types of stains like if they are extrinsic simple scaling and polishing will be sufficient where as intrinsic stains need some complex treatment. Thank you.

What you remove during brushing is the plaque which is a soft and sticky layer on the teeth..... once this plaque hardens, it becomes calculus which is seen as a yellowish layer on the teeth and this cannot be removed by brushing but requires professional intervention in the form of the procedure called scaling..... additionally, bleaching can be done to whiten your teeth further.....
